Fall Makeup Must-Haves: Drugstore Edition!


With the beginning of autumn officially starting next week I thought I'd share my favorite makeup products from the drugstore I will undoubtedly be wearing the entire season.


NYX Love in Paris: Pardon My French ($12.99)
I was obsessed with this palate all season last year and I know the same will be true this year. The copper toned shadows in this palate are perfect to incorporate fall colors into your makeup look without going to over the top. This palate is perfect for anyone who wants to experiment with some autumn hues without looking too bold.
Maybelline Dream Bouncy Blush: Plum Wine ($7.99)
 As the weather gets a little cooler I love to wear a darker blush on my cheeks. This beautiful plum color gives the illusion of frost bitten cheeks which I absolutely love. This is probably my all time favorite blush formula so I definitely recommend checking this one out.

 
Milani Color Statement Lipstick: Matte Confident & Black Cherry ($5.99)
Milani has, in my opinion, the best lipstick formula at the drugstore. These lipsticks are insanely pigmented and my perfect fall colors. I love the deep berry tone of 'Black Cherry' it's the perfect vampy lip for the fall time. 'Matte Confident' is my ideal matte red lipstick that transitions throughout the whole year, but I find myself using it the most in autumn.
 Maybelline Color Tattoo Crayon: Bronze Truffle($6.99)
I have an entire post dedicated to this product which I'll link here. This product has proved especially perfect during the back to school season. When I have to get to school early in the morning the last thing I have time to do is put on eyeshadow, but this product is so easy that it takes me less than 10 seconds so I can get to school on time.
Essence Make Me Brow: Browny Brows($2.99)
The last product I'm mentioning in this post is the ultimate dupe for Benefit's 'Gimme Brow' with a $27 price difference I'd 100% recommend trying out this steal before splurging on the Benefit one. This is so simple to sweep through my eyebrows to get rid of any sparse areas without making my eyebrows look too over done.
